To be honest, I think how Odoo handles apps since V12 is very insincere. I'm looking at purchasing Odoo Enterprise for my very small company and the Allure apps looks very interesting. However...because of the new app policy, that means I would need to pay $600 a year for a ported app with exactly the same features. I understand the change is to help developers make a living, but there should be a 50% discount or something for people who want to upgrade their apps to be able to use them when Odoo updates itself. Before it was like, every app update was free indefinitely. Now it's you need to pay a fortune to keep compatibility or be stuck never upgrading anything. I think there should be an in-between option, such as a discounted upgrade for people who already purchased the app. Odoo helped developers here, but I think there should be a happy medium. Odoo customers aren't all multi-million or multi-billion dollar companies. So...I won't purchase this app personally. I will go bankrupt trying to upgrade it every year. I think also, that the app developers could sell apps on their own website, and have their own upgrade policy instead of relying on Odoo to set the rules. I think it's an excuse. And, well, maybe for cheap apps this new policy might be okay, but for expensive ones it just doesn't make any sense. I think expensive apps that are "nice to have" but not requires will lose more sales because of the lack of an upgrade path. But, I'm not an Odoo developer, so I won't have the data to prove that :p Cool app though. Maybe in the future when they have a more sensible upgrade path I would certainly consider it.
